Articles of android youtube api

YouTubePlayer не загружает рекламное видео с помощью cueVideo ()

Я использую YouTubePlayer для воспроизведения видео на YouTube и использования cueVideo(videoId) для загрузки видео, которое отлично работает, если видео не содержит Ad, но видео содержит Ad, а затем cueVideo(videoId) не загружает видео. Также видно, что некоторые обсуждения касаются такой проблемы, которая предлагается использовать loadVideo(videoId) вместо cueVideo(videoId) но в соответствии с моим требованием я показывал изображение […]

Как загрузить YouTubePlayer с помощью YouTubePlayerFragment внутри другого фрагмента? (Android)

Я хочу загрузить YoutubePlayer в фрагмент, используя YouTubePlayerFragment из API Файл .xml моего фрагмента: <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="match_parent" android:layout_height="match_parent"> <!– VIDEO CONTENT –>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="match_parent" android:layout_height="0dp" android:layout_weight="1" android:paddingLeft="@dimen/layout_horizontal_margin" android:paddingRight="@dimen/layout_horizontal_margin" android:paddingTop="@dimen/layout_vertical_margin" android:paddingBottom="@dimen/layout_vertical_margin" > <fragment android:name="com.google.android.youtube.player.YouTubePlayerFragment" android:id="@+id/youtubeplayer_fragment" android:layout_width="match_parent" android:layout_height="wrap_content"/> </LinearLayout> <!– LYRIC CONTENT –> <R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ical" android:layout_width="match_parent" android:layout_height="0dp" android:layout_weight="2" > <LinearLayout […]

Доступ к неконфигурированному ключу API Google Android

Я пытаюсь использовать Youtube Data API v3 для поиска на Android, хотя, когда я пытаюсь выполнить поиск с помощью моего ключа API, я всегда получаю это сообщение: { "error": { "errors": [ { "domain": "usageLimits", "reason": "accessNotConfigured", "message": "Access Not Configured. Please use Google Developers Console to activate the API for your project." } ], […]

YouTube api: не подключен. Вызовите connect () и дождитесь, когда onConnected () будет вызван

Я использую YouTubeFragment в приложении для Android и получаю следующие сбои на устройствах Android 4+. java.lang.IllegalStateException: Not connected. Call connect() and wait for onConnected() to be called. at com.google.android.youtube.player.a.at.i(Unknown Source) at com.google.android.youtube.player.a.an.k(Unknown Source) at com.google.android.youtube.player.a.an.a(Unknown Source) at com.google.android.youtube.player.a.ao.<init>(Unknown Source) at com.google.android.youtube.player.afa(Unknown Source) at com.google.android.youtube.player.qa(Unknown Source) at com.google.android.youtube.player.a.at.g(Unknown Source) at com.google.android.youtube.player.a.ax.a(Unknown Source) at com.google.android.youtube.player.a.aw.a(Unknown Source) at […]

Youtube SDK падает с DeadObjectException при переходе в приложение YouTube

Мое приложение обеспечивает просмотр youtube с помощью Youtube Android SDK. Нет проблем с показом видео, но он вылетает с DeadObjectException при открытии приложения youtube. Мой код выглядит следующим образом: //init FragmentTransaction fragmentTransaction = fm.beginTransaction(); YouTubePlayerSupportFragment fragment = new YouTubePlayerSupportFragment(); fragmentTransaction.replace(R.id.fragmentz, fragment); fragmentTransaction.commit(); fragment.initialize(Constants.YOUTUBE_DEV_KEY, this); @Override public void onInitializationSuccess(YouTubePlayer.Provider provider, final YouTubePlayer youTubePlayer, boolean wasRestored) { […]

YouTubePlayerSupportFragment в однозависимом приложении с изменением ориентации

Я попытался решить эту проблему, обыскав через Интернет, никакого реального ответа не найдено. Я разрабатываю приложение, в котором необходим плеер YouTube. Этот проигрыватель является YouTubePlayerSupportFragment так как он находится в фрагменте поддержки (поэтому он также вложен). После первоначальной настройки я понял, что всякий раз, когда я поворачиваю телефон, видео перестает играть, и его нужно снова […]

API Android L Youtube – IllegalArgumentException: служебное намерение должно быть явным

Я знаю, что на LI можно связывать только службы, объявленные явно. В моем приложении я в настоящее время использую Youtube API и при работе на устройствах с LI всегда получаю эту ошибку java.lang.IllegalArgumentException: Service Intent must be explicit: Intent { act=com.google.android.youtube.api.service.START } Как я могу исправить проблему, так как Youtube API работает также на L?

Android 4.4 Случайный сбой KitKat (Родной сбой в /system/lib/libc.so)

Я создал приложение, которое воспроизводит видео YouTube iframe через WebView и контролирует видео с YouTube iframe api. (Я знаю, что YouTube SDK для Android может быть более рекомендован для разработки приложений для Android, но пока только iframe api соответствует нашей потребности) Я узнал, что приложение случайно сбой при работе под Android 4.4 KitKat. Это полный […]

Вставить видео Youtube в приложение для Android

Я использую WebView для отображения встроенного видео Youtube и работает на Galaxcy S2 (OS 2.3.5) и не работает на Nexus S (OS 2.3.4), все, что я получаю, это белый экран без какого-либо видеодисплея. Вот фрагмент кода, который я использую, и объявления в файле манифеста: private WebView wv; private void setWebView() { wv = (WebView) findViewById(R.id.webView); […]

Воспроизведение видео на YouTube с помощью ExoPlayer

Я заинтересован в использовании воспроизведения ExoPlayer для воспроизведения на YouTube. Из примеров ExoPlayer я вижу, что они воспроизводят видео YouTube через URL-адреса DASH. Я использую API YouTube YouTube для поиска видео и не вижу средств для получения URL-адреса DASH для любого из результатов поиска. Кто-нибудь знает какие-либо образцы для интеграции API YouTube (v3) с ExoPlayer […]